A last-minute penalty from Newbury fly-half Mitch Burton condemned Launceston to their first defeat in seven games. Launceston scored twice early on with tries from Bryn Jenkins and Jon Fabian. In the second period Josh Lord extended Launceston's advantage, but Newbury came back to take the lead after tries from Chris Ridgers and Dan Hodge. A late penalty try gave Launceston a two-point advantage, before Burton stepped up in the dying moments to steal the win. Despite the defeat Launceston stay third in National One with 60 points, whilst Newbury are now seventh with 45 points.
